Vulnerability Description
A flaw was found in oVirt. A user with administrator privileges, including users with the ReadOnlyAdmin permission, may be able to use browser developer tools to view Provider passwords in cleartext.
CVSS Score
MEDIUM
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Ovirt | Ovirt-Engine | < 4.5.7 |
| Redhat | Virtualization | 4.0 |
